Host: David Riedman, creator of the K-12 School Shooting Database.

Guest: Shea Swauger is a PhD student in Education and Critical Studies at the University of Colorado Denver. He researches social factors that influence school shootings and gun policy.

David Riedman is the creator of the K-12 School Shooting Database, Chief Data Officer at a global risk management firm, and a tenure-track professor.
